So join us as we share information and low fat, raw vegan recipes some of our planet's most amazing foods! The fruit of Day 22 is the AVOCADO! I know, I know, one of the themes of this Project is "low fat," and since when was an avocado low-in- fat? Ok, they do contain quite a bit of fat (30 grams in one--but it's "good fat" and has been shown to help lower LDL cholesterol levels), but I'm not recommending you eat bunches and bunches of avocados each day. As you've probably noticed, an avocados flavor goes pretty far--you don't need much to make a delicious "avocado" difference in whatever you're eating. And now for the AVOCADO info I think you'll find interesting: -There are over 500 different avocado varieties! -Avocados are an excellent source of: Protein Carotenoids--specifically Lutein Vitamin E Fiber Potassium Folate -The high carotenoid and mono-unsaturated fat content have been shown to lower the risk of prostate cancer, lower LDL ("bad") cholesterol, and raise HDL ("good") cholesterol levels ...
